Mental Hygiene
The practice of maintaining mental health through the prevention and treatment of mental disorders, as well as by promoting healthy lifestyles and environments.
Antisocial Personality
A disorder characterized by a pervasive pattern of disregard for, and violation of, the rights of others.
Drug Abuse Disorder
A medical condition characterized by the compulsive use of drugs despite harmful consequences, leading to mental and physical health issues.
Network Therapy
A therapeutic approach involving a patient's social network (family, friends, etc.) in the treatment process for mental health or substance abuse issues.
